Indexomorganisering är en process där SQL Server går igenom det befintliga indexet och rensar upp det. Indexombyggnad är en tung process där ett index raderas och sedan återskapas från grunden med en helt ny struktur, fri från alla upphopade fragment och tomma sidor.
Vad är skillnaden mellan Bygg om index och omorganisera i SQL Server?
Rebuild: rebuild tappar det befintliga indexet och återskapar igen. Omorganisera: omorganisera fysiskt ordna indexets bladnoder. Om indexfragmenteringen visar över 40%.
Ska jag bygga om eller omorganisera index?
En ombyggnad av index kommer alltid att bygga ett nytt index, även om det inte finns någon fragmentering. … Det betyder att för ett lätt fragmenterat index (t.ex. mindre än 30 % fragmentering) är det i allmänhet snabbare att omorganisera indexet, men för ett mer fragmenterat index är det i allmänhet snabbare att bara bygga om indexet.
Vad är att bygga om ett index?
Att bygga om ett index innebär att tar bort det gamla indexet och ersätter det med ett nytt index. Genom att utföra en ombyggnad av index eliminerar fragmentering, komprimerar sidorna baserat på den befintliga fyllningsfaktorinställningen för att återta lagringsutrymme och ordnar också om indexraderna till sammanhängande sidor.
Är det nödvändigt att bygga om index?
Var så ofta behöver vi bygga om index i Oracle, eftersomindex blir fragmenterade med tiden. Detta gör att deras prestanda - och i förlängningen - den för dina databasfrågor, försämras. … Med det sagt bör index inte byggas om till ofta, eftersom det är en resurskrävande uppgift.